Released November 11th, 2002, 'Storm' stars Warren Miller, Chris Anthony, Micah Black, Bob Rankin The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 33 min, and received a user score of 52 (out of 100) on TMDb, which put together reviews from 2 experienced users.

Here's the plot: "You cant have all the things we love like skiing and snow without a good Storm Follow along as skiers and riders like Seth Morrison Toby Dawson Jeremy Bloom Tanner Hall and Glen Plake tackle every condition and obstacle in their way head on in order to ski some of the freshest snow around Warren Miller takes you on a trip from Idaho California and Colorado all the way to Canada Austria and even to the distant country of Georgia and along the way proves that a good Storm can happen wherever youre at"
